Market Notes

Compared to last week, slaughter cows and bulls traded steady. Demand was good on a moderate supply.

Supply included: 90% Slaughter Cattle (90% Cows, 10% Bulls); 10% Replacement Cattle (41% Stock Cows, 46% Bred Cows, 8% Bred Heifers, 5% Cow-Calf Pairs). AUCTION This Week Last Reported 5/16/2022 Last Year Total Receipts: 505 500 407 Slaughter Cattle: 454(89.9%) 418(83.6%) 281(69.0%) Replacement Cattle: 51(10.1%) 82(16.4%) 126(31.0%)
